When the lights go out, or a brand-new connection is required, the majority of us envision the familiar electrician, multimeter in hand, ready to detect and fix. Nevertheless, an essential and frequently neglected sector of the electrical trade guarantees the extremely power gets to our homes and companies in the first place: the Level 2 Electrician. These extremely skilled experts are the backbone of the low-voltage circulation network, bridging the gap between the extensive utility infrastructure and your home's electrical system.

A Level 2 Electrician isn't your everyday sparky. Their function extends far beyond internal circuitry and device installation. They are authorised to deal with the service network, the part of the electrical system that connects a residential or commercial property to the primary power grid. This involves an unique set of abilities, substantial training, and a deep understanding of security protocols, as they often interact with live electrical mains. Consider them as the experts who deal with the heavy lifting, guaranteeing a safe and dependable flow of electrical energy from the street pole or underground pit straight to your switchboard.

One of their main duties is overhead and underground service work. This might include setting up brand-new connections for a newly developed home, updating existing services to accommodate increased power needs, or fixing damaged overhead lines after a storm. Think of a branch falling across a power line, or an old connection struggling to manage modern energy usage; it's the Level 2 Electrician who will be dispatched to assess, ensure, and bring back the vital link. Their competence in operating at heights and in confined spaces, often in difficult weather conditions, is vital to preserving the integrity of the power supply.

Another critical aspect of their work involves metering. They are the ones who set up, eliminate, and transfer electricity meters, guaranteeing accurate consumption readings for energy service providers. This isn't an easy job; it requires careful attention to information and adherence to rigorous guidelines to prevent tampering and make sure reasonable billing. They also play an essential function in linking photovoltaic panels to the grid, assisting in the flow of tidy energy back into the network and making it possible for house owners to gain from sustainable power. This includes elaborate electrical wiring, cautious consideration of grid stability, and a thorough understanding of wise meter technology.

In addition, Level 2 Electricians are important throughout power failures. While the major power business restore the core network, these experts often deal with localised faults in between the street and specific properties. A snapped service cable television, a blown fuse at the pole, or concerns with the point of accessory on a structure-- these are all within their province. Their fast action and analytical capabilities are vital in minimising disruption and restoring power to affected residents and services as quickly and securely as possible. They are frequently the unrecognized heroes working vigilantly through the night or in unfavorable conditions to get the lights back on.

The path to becoming a Level 2 Electrician is rigorous and requiring. It normally involves finishing a standard electrical apprenticeship, gaining significant experience as a qualified electrician, and after that undertaking specialised training and accreditation with an authorised provider. This extra training covers sophisticated security procedures, specific devices operation, and in-depth understanding of the low-voltage distribution network's complexities. They must likewise keep their accreditation through continuous expert development, remaining abreast of evolving innovations and security requirements. This commitment to constant knowing highlights the complexity and responsibility of their role.
